Did you know there are a lot of kind of expressions used in Venezia that helps you to not get lost on those little streets?? (for me.. forget..:-)) )
so:
calle - street
rio - canal
campo - square

also..
fondamenta - little street among the canal, usually with the same name
rio terra - filled canal
piscina - square
sotoportico - covered passage
salizzada - main street
riva - wider fondamenta
ruga - street with small shops on both sides
corte - courtyard of a house or castle

PLS note.. In Venezia streets may have more than one name.. then both names are appearing, separated with an 'o' that means 'or'...
